When Portugal and Cristiano Ronaldo won Euro 2016, it came after a campaign that looked doomed by a series of calamities.

'No one believed in us,' Cristiano Ronaldo said eight summers ago, trying to fight back tears, and ultimately losing the battle. 'No one believed in Portugal.' History only shows that Portugal won the European Championship in 2016, and that it remains, at least for the next two weeks and possibly forever, the only major international trophy won by Ronaldo.

That tournament was the first Euros in which the field had been expanded to 24, meaning third-place teams could now advance, and Portugal took full advantage of the change. It was a wild ride to the title, under head coach Fernando Santos, and it was a mightily worthy — some would say necessary — endorsement to Ronaldo's glittering career résumé.
